WHAT IS IT?
​Toddlers may walk with their heels lifted when beginning to walk independently.  At the age of 2, children begin to develop walking patterns similar to adults and by the age of 3, the child has developed a mature walking pattern, thus the heel-toe pattern should be present. Idiopathic Toe Walking, also known as Habitual Toe Walking, refers to a child who stays on their toes while walking.
WHAT CAUSES IT?
​Idiopathic Toe Walking is often caused by shortening of the calf muscles rather than another underlying condition.
  1. Neurological – coming from the nervous system (ie. Cerebral Palsy)
  2. Myogenic – coming from a problem in the muscle tissue (ie. Muscular Dystrophy)
  3. Congenital – the way your child has grown (ie. Clubfeet)
In children with Idiopathic Toe Walking, they are usually able to stand with flat feet and Toe Walking may be inconsistent.  However, children with Cerebral Palsy are up on their toes consistently when standing and walking.  The greatest difference is the presence of Spasticity (the muscle is unable to relax) in the ankle, knee or hips in children with Cerebral Palsy, where as spasticity is not present in children with Idiopathic Toe Walking.​
HOW CAN PHYSIO HELP?
The main purpose of physiotherapy is to increase the flexibility of the calf muscle, allowing adequate movement in the ankle to allow heel toe walking pattern.  Active Solution Physiotherapy Verdun’s pediatric physiotherapists will develop a home program that includes stretching exercises to ensure adequate movement of the ankle when walking and strengthening exercises to ensure proper development.
